1C 7.7 Комплексная 495. Формирование проводок по зарплате: "Деление на 0" .
28.02.2010
11:57
#1
"При формировании проводок по начислению зарплаты за январь и февраль 2010 года возникает ошибка:
СтавкаПФР_страх = Окр(100 * ИсчисленоПФРСтрахЕНВД / ОблагаемаяБазаПФРЕНВД,2);
{Глобальный модуль(50453)}: Деление на 0
Ошибка при формировании проводок по людям, находящимся в отпуске по уходу за ребенком. Т.е. все логично: облагаемая база ПФР и ЕНВД у них равна 0. Но почему по ним пытается считать взносы напонятно. В проводке указано, что объект не облагается взносами. Может неправильно настроены проводки? Или это ошибка конфигурации?"
СтавкаПФР_страх = Окр(100 * ИсчисленоПФРСтрахЕНВД / ОблагаемаяБазаПФРЕНВД,2);
{Глобальный модуль(50453)}: Деление на 0
Ошибка при формировании проводок по людям, находящимся в отпуске по уходу за ребенком. Т.е. все логично: облагаемая база ПФР и ЕНВД у них равна 0. Но почему по ним пытается считать взносы напонятно. В проводке указано, что объект не облагается взносами. Может неправильно настроены проводки? Или это ошибка конфигурации?"
28.02.2010
13:07
#3
Убил на поиск не один час. Наверное я немного туплю. Можно хотя бы ссылку на это обсуждение?
28.02.2010
15:26
#5
Спасибо. Оказывается, опять 1Сники начудили. Сколько же геморроя с этой комплексной, начиная с 493 релиза ....
01.03.2010
11:17
#7
"Как советуют:
а пока наверно лучше проверять на 0 непосредственно при вызове "ОблагаемаяБазаПФРЕНВД" .
Вызывается в глобальнике она в 4 местах. Строки можно поиском найти.
Например:
строка 50056
СтавкаВТаблицуПФРСтраховаяЧастьЕНВД = ?(ОблагаемаяБазаПФРЕНВД = 0,0,Окр(100 * ИсчисленоПФРСтрахЕНВД / ОблагаемаяБазаПФРЕНВД,2));"
а пока наверно лучше проверять на 0 непосредственно при вызове "ОблагаемаяБазаПФРЕНВД" .
Вызывается в глобальнике она в 4 местах. Строки можно поиском найти.
Например:
строка 50056
СтавкаВТаблицуПФРСтраховаяЧастьЕНВД = ?(ОблагаемаяБазаПФРЕНВД = 0,0,Окр(100 * ИсчисленоПФРСтрахЕНВД / ОблагаемаяБазаПФРЕНВД,2));"
Читают тему
(гостей: 1)